Celebrate the 250th anniversary of the American Revolution in Virginia with a living history event at George Washington’s Ferry Farm! Inside the Washington House, delve into the years leading up to the revolution, culminating in the pivotal year of 1774.
In each room, interactive living history stations will portray various aspects of 18th-century life. Guests can try their hand at a card game while learning about the Stamp Act or watch a dance demonstration to gain insight into 18th-century social life. Learn why this significant period spurred Virginians, including George Washington, to rally behind the revolutionary cause.
